Moran: There are many different strategies we use

00:01:08.406 --> 00:01:10.956
in our classroom to reduce behavior problems.

00:01:11.196 --> 00:01:16.056
We have a behavior chart that we tape to individuals' desks,

00:01:16.056 --> 00:01:19.436
and each behavior chart is tailored to meet their individual needs.

00:01:19.926 --> 00:01:25.216
For example, if there is one child in our class who we're working on to give more put ups

00:01:25.606 --> 00:01:31.006
to other classmates of hers, to see her use encouraging words or be kind to others.

00:01:31.416 --> 00:01:36.026
So, I have a chart stating what we like her to work on with a smiley face,

00:01:36.116 --> 00:01:40.296
and either she'll color in the face to see how she is doing throughout the day

00:01:40.296 --> 00:01:41.616
or we will place a sticker on it.

00:01:42.176 --> 00:01:43.756
In another case we have a daily chart.

00:01:44.126 --> 00:01:49.066
This might be for the child who needs a little more of a push to begin his or her school day

00:01:49.246 --> 00:01:51.736
and see their progress academically,

00:01:51.736 --> 00:01:54.016
if they are completing their assignments in a timely fashion.

00:01:54.016 --> 00:01:57.876
And this will just be labeled period zero, period one,

00:01:57.926 --> 00:02:00.716
period two and it's a simple remark or sentence.

00:02:01.466 --> 00:02:04.356
Each behavior contract has an incentive.

00:02:04.526 --> 00:02:06.986
The children are able to come to their treasure chest

00:02:06.986 --> 00:02:09.756
to receive a sweet treat or school supplies.

Moran: In the beginning of the school year,

00:02:50.676 --> 00:02:54.986
we brainstorm with the children our classroom norms and expectations,

00:02:55.496 --> 00:03:00.076
also the rewards and consequences if the classroom norms aren't followed.

00:03:00.366 --> 00:03:03.396
The children brainstorm in their groups and then we have a share out.

00:03:03.596 --> 00:03:08.246
We jot down their ideas, and we confer with them and ask them if they are in agreement with it.

00:03:08.806 --> 00:03:14.896
Then, we'll type up their classroom norms, expectations, rewards, and consequences,

00:03:15.546 --> 00:03:19.306
and we'll present it the following day to the children and ask them to sign it.

00:03:19.476 --> 00:03:23.796
They're aware signing something is a contract, and we expect you to follow it.

00:03:23.936 --> 00:03:25.646
We refer to it throughout the school year.

00:03:26.136 --> 00:03:30.586
Behavior is managed and controled using different various techniques in our classroom.

00:03:31.296 --> 00:03:41.736
For example, we have a clap pattern [clapping],

00:03:41.736 --> 00:03:45.486
and we use this technique when the children are working in groups and we want them

00:03:45.486 --> 00:03:50.346
to draw their attention back on the teacher, so then we can move into the next activity.

00:03:50.686 --> 00:03:56.996
Also, if the children need to use the bathroom, they sign the word bathroom, simply like this,

00:03:56.996 --> 00:04:01.896
and they know to wiggle their hand a little bit and wait for a head nod from either teacher

00:04:01.896 --> 00:04:05.676
in the class to permit them to use the bathroom, and then they go ahead.

00:04:06.086 --> 00:04:07.826
And these different hand gestures we use

00:04:07.826 --> 00:04:11.156
in the class minimizes other children from being distracted.
